The USB Low-Level Format 5.01 software, developed by BureauSoft, is a utility designed to restore USB flash drives to their factory default settings by performing a "zero-fill" operation. This process is particularly useful for fixing drives with corrupted partition tables, invalid sector sizes, or persistent data corruption. Key Features of Version 5.01

Q: Can I recover data after a low-level format? A: Generally, no. A true low-level format overwrites the data sectors, making recovery impossible with standard software. This is why it is used for security wiping.
